About Yunsang Kim
Yunsang Kim is a scholar working on Polymers and Plastics, Biomaterials and Conservation, having authored 33 papers that have together received 746 indexed citations. Recurring topics across this work include Advanced Cellulose Research Studies (8 papers), Advanced Sensor and Energy Harvesting Materials (8 papers) and Lignin and Wood Chemistry (7 papers). The work is most often cited by research in Polymers and Plastics (225 citations), Biomedical Engineering (452 citations) and Biomaterials (134 citations). Yunsang Kim has collaborated with scholars based in United States, South Korea and Belgium. Frequent co-authors include Xuefeng Zhang, Joseph W. Perry, Rubin Shmulsky, Dragica Jeremic, Seth R. Marder, Sergio A. Paniagua, Katherine Henry, Ritesh Kumar, Thomas L. Eberhardt and Lili Cai. Their work appears in journals such as Advanced Energy Materials, Chemical Engineering Journal and ACS Applied Materials & Interfaces.
